All articles are generated by AI, they are all just for seo purpose.
If you get this page, welcome to have a try at our funny and useful apps or games.
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.
## F Player: iOS Audio and Video Prowess
The iOS ecosystem is renowned for its intuitive user experience and polished applications. While Apple provides native media players, often referred to as "Apple Music" and "Videos," many users seek alternative applications to tailor their media consumption experience. This is where third-party media players like "F Player" (a hypothetical name, but representative of many such apps) step in, offering enhanced features, format support, and customization options.
This article will explore the potential functionalities of F Player, an imagined iOS application designed to provide a comprehensive audio and video playback experience. We will delve into its potential features, user interface, format compatibility, customization options, and potential advantages over the native iOS media players. While focusing on the theoretical F Player, this exploration will reflect the common desires and expectations users have when seeking alternative media playback solutions on their iOS devices.
**Core Functionality: Beyond Basic Playback**
At its core, F Player aims to provide a superior audio and video playback experience. This goes beyond simply pressing play. Key functionalities would include:
* **Seamless Playback:** Smooth, uninterrupted playback across a wide range of file formats is paramount. This includes support for common formats like MP3, AAC, WAV, MP4, MOV, AVI, MKV, and FLAC. F Player should strive to minimize buffering, stuttering, or playback errors, offering a reliable and enjoyable viewing/listening experience.
* **Playback Speed Control:** The ability to adjust playback speed is crucial for various scenarios, such as catching up on podcasts at 1.5x speed or meticulously analyzing video footage at a slower pace. F Player should offer granular control over playback speed, allowing users to fine-tune it to their specific needs.
* **Looping and Repeat Functionality:** Repeating a song or a video section is a common requirement. F Player should provide intuitive options for looping entire tracks, specific segments (A-B repeat), or playlists.
* **Background Playback:** For audio, background playback is a necessity. Users should be able to continue listening to music or podcasts even when the app is minimized or the screen is locked. This functionality needs to be robust and reliable, even with resource-intensive tasks running in the background.
* **AirPlay and Chromecast Support:** Seamless integration with AirPlay and Chromecast allows users to easily stream audio and video to compatible devices like smart TVs, speakers, and other displays. F Player should provide intuitive controls for selecting output devices and managing the streaming process.
**A User Interface Designed for Media Consumption**
The user interface (UI) of F Player is crucial for a positive user experience. It should be intuitive, visually appealing, and easy to navigate, even with large media libraries. Key elements of the UI would include:
* **Clean and Modern Design:** A minimalist design with a clear hierarchy of information is essential. The UI should be visually appealing and uncluttered, allowing users to focus on the content.
* **Intuitive Navigation:** Easy access to playlists, folders, and search functionality is paramount. The navigation should be straightforward and logical, minimizing the number of taps required to access desired content.
* **Customizable Themes:** Allowing users to personalize the app's appearance with different themes enhances the overall user experience. Themes could offer variations in color schemes, background images, and font styles.
* **Gestural Controls:** Incorporating gestural controls, such as swipe gestures for skipping tracks or adjusting volume, provides a more fluid and intuitive interaction.
* **Cover Art Display:** Displaying cover art for audio files and thumbnails for video files enhances the browsing experience and makes it easier to identify content.
* **Library Management:** A robust library management system is crucial for organizing large collections of audio and video files. This includes features such as:
* **Folder-Based Browsing:** Allowing users to navigate their media library based on folders.
* **Tag Editing:** Enabling users to edit metadata tags (e.g., title, artist, album) for audio files.
* **Playlist Creation and Management:** Providing intuitive tools for creating, organizing, and managing playlists.
* **Smart Playlists:** Automatically generating playlists based on user-defined criteria (e.g., most played, recently added).
* **Media Scanning and Indexing:** Automatically scanning the device for media files and indexing them for easy access.
**Format Compatibility: Bridging the Gap**
One of the primary motivations for seeking alternative media players is often the need for broader format compatibility. While the native iOS media players support common formats, they often fall short when it comes to less common or specialized formats. F Player should strive to support a wide range of audio and video formats, including:
* **Audio:** MP3, AAC, WAV, FLAC, ALAC, OGG Vorbis, WMA, APE, DSD. The inclusion of lossless formats like FLAC and ALAC is particularly important for audiophiles.
* **Video:** MP4, MOV, AVI, MKV, WMV, FLV, WebM, H.264, H.265 (HEVC), VP9. Support for MKV containers and newer codecs like H.265 and VP9 is crucial for playing a wide range of video content.
Furthermore, F Player should include:
* **Codec Support:** Leveraging both hardware and software codecs to ensure optimal playback performance for all supported formats.
* **Automatic Codec Updates:** Regularly updating codecs to maintain compatibility with the latest media formats.
* **Error Handling:** Providing informative error messages when encountering unsupported formats or codec issues.
**Customization: Tailoring the Experience**
The ability to customize the playback experience is a key differentiator for third-party media players. F Player should offer a range of customization options, allowing users to fine-tune the app to their preferences. These could include:
* **Equalizer:** A customizable equalizer allows users to adjust the frequency response of audio playback to suit their listening preferences. F Player should offer a range of preset equalizer settings (e.g., rock, jazz, classical) as well as the ability to create and save custom equalizer profiles.
* **Video Playback Settings:** Customizable video playback settings, such as brightness, contrast, saturation, and hue, allow users to optimize the viewing experience.
* **Subtitle Support:** Support for external subtitle files (e.g., SRT, ASS, SSA) is crucial for watching foreign films or videos with dialogue that is difficult to understand. F Player should allow users to load subtitle files, customize their appearance (e.g., font, size, color), and adjust their synchronization with the video.
* **Audio Boost and Normalization:** Audio boost can amplify the volume of quiet audio tracks, while audio normalization can even out the volume levels across different tracks.
* **Gesture Customization:** Allowing users to customize the functionality of gesture controls provides a more personalized and efficient interaction.
* **Sleep Timer:** A sleep timer allows users to automatically stop playback after a specified period of time, which is particularly useful for listening to music or podcasts before bed.
**Advantages Over Native iOS Media Players**
While the native iOS media players are functional and well-integrated into the ecosystem, F Player can offer several advantages:
* **Wider Format Compatibility:** Native players often lack support for certain formats like MKV, FLAC, and some codecs.
* **Enhanced Customization:** Native players typically offer limited customization options.
* **Advanced Features:** Features like playback speed control, A-B repeat, and more granular equalizer settings are often missing in native players.
* **Library Management:** F Player can provide more robust library management features, particularly for users with large media collections.
* **Cross-Platform Support:** While F Player is envisioned as an iOS app, many similar apps offer versions for other platforms (Android, macOS, Windows), allowing users to seamlessly sync their media libraries across devices.
**Potential Challenges and Considerations**
Developing a successful media player app for iOS presents several challenges:
* **Resource Constraints:** iOS devices have limited processing power and battery life. F Player needs to be optimized for performance to minimize battery drain and prevent overheating.
* **Memory Management:** Efficient memory management is crucial to prevent crashes and ensure smooth playback, especially with large media files.
* **iOS Updates:** Apple regularly releases iOS updates that can introduce changes that affect the functionality of third-party apps. F Player needs to be regularly updated to maintain compatibility with the latest iOS versions.
* **DRM and Copyright:** Handling DRM-protected content requires careful consideration to avoid copyright infringement.
* **App Store Approval:** Apple has strict guidelines for app store approval. F Player needs to adhere to these guidelines to be approved and remain available in the App Store.
**Conclusion**
F Player, as a hypothetical iOS media player, represents the desire for a more feature-rich, customizable, and versatile media playback experience on Apple devices. By offering broader format compatibility, enhanced customization options, and advanced features, F Player can cater to the needs of users who seek more control over their audio and video consumption. While challenges exist in developing and maintaining such an application, the potential benefits for users seeking a superior media playback experience are significant. The success of F Player, or any similar app, hinges on a combination of robust functionality, intuitive design, and a commitment to ongoing development and support. In a market saturated with streaming services, there's still a significant demand for offline playback and personalized media management, making a well-executed media player a valuable addition to the iOS app ecosystem.
The iOS ecosystem is renowned for its intuitive user experience and polished applications. While Apple provides native media players, often referred to as "Apple Music" and "Videos," many users seek alternative applications to tailor their media consumption experience. This is where third-party media players like "F Player" (a hypothetical name, but representative of many such apps) step in, offering enhanced features, format support, and customization options.
This article will explore the potential functionalities of F Player, an imagined iOS application designed to provide a comprehensive audio and video playback experience. We will delve into its potential features, user interface, format compatibility, customization options, and potential advantages over the native iOS media players. While focusing on the theoretical F Player, this exploration will reflect the common desires and expectations users have when seeking alternative media playback solutions on their iOS devices.
**Core Functionality: Beyond Basic Playback**
At its core, F Player aims to provide a superior audio and video playback experience. This goes beyond simply pressing play. Key functionalities would include:
* **Seamless Playback:** Smooth, uninterrupted playback across a wide range of file formats is paramount. This includes support for common formats like MP3, AAC, WAV, MP4, MOV, AVI, MKV, and FLAC. F Player should strive to minimize buffering, stuttering, or playback errors, offering a reliable and enjoyable viewing/listening experience.
* **Playback Speed Control:** The ability to adjust playback speed is crucial for various scenarios, such as catching up on podcasts at 1.5x speed or meticulously analyzing video footage at a slower pace. F Player should offer granular control over playback speed, allowing users to fine-tune it to their specific needs.
* **Looping and Repeat Functionality:** Repeating a song or a video section is a common requirement. F Player should provide intuitive options for looping entire tracks, specific segments (A-B repeat), or playlists.
* **Background Playback:** For audio, background playback is a necessity. Users should be able to continue listening to music or podcasts even when the app is minimized or the screen is locked. This functionality needs to be robust and reliable, even with resource-intensive tasks running in the background.
* **AirPlay and Chromecast Support:** Seamless integration with AirPlay and Chromecast allows users to easily stream audio and video to compatible devices like smart TVs, speakers, and other displays. F Player should provide intuitive controls for selecting output devices and managing the streaming process.
**A User Interface Designed for Media Consumption**
The user interface (UI) of F Player is crucial for a positive user experience. It should be intuitive, visually appealing, and easy to navigate, even with large media libraries. Key elements of the UI would include:
* **Clean and Modern Design:** A minimalist design with a clear hierarchy of information is essential. The UI should be visually appealing and uncluttered, allowing users to focus on the content.
* **Intuitive Navigation:** Easy access to playlists, folders, and search functionality is paramount. The navigation should be straightforward and logical, minimizing the number of taps required to access desired content.
* **Customizable Themes:** Allowing users to personalize the app's appearance with different themes enhances the overall user experience. Themes could offer variations in color schemes, background images, and font styles.
* **Gestural Controls:** Incorporating gestural controls, such as swipe gestures for skipping tracks or adjusting volume, provides a more fluid and intuitive interaction.
* **Cover Art Display:** Displaying cover art for audio files and thumbnails for video files enhances the browsing experience and makes it easier to identify content.
* **Library Management:** A robust library management system is crucial for organizing large collections of audio and video files. This includes features such as:
* **Folder-Based Browsing:** Allowing users to navigate their media library based on folders.
* **Tag Editing:** Enabling users to edit metadata tags (e.g., title, artist, album) for audio files.
* **Playlist Creation and Management:** Providing intuitive tools for creating, organizing, and managing playlists.
* **Smart Playlists:** Automatically generating playlists based on user-defined criteria (e.g., most played, recently added).
* **Media Scanning and Indexing:** Automatically scanning the device for media files and indexing them for easy access.
**Format Compatibility: Bridging the Gap**
One of the primary motivations for seeking alternative media players is often the need for broader format compatibility. While the native iOS media players support common formats, they often fall short when it comes to less common or specialized formats. F Player should strive to support a wide range of audio and video formats, including:
* **Audio:** MP3, AAC, WAV, FLAC, ALAC, OGG Vorbis, WMA, APE, DSD. The inclusion of lossless formats like FLAC and ALAC is particularly important for audiophiles.
* **Video:** MP4, MOV, AVI, MKV, WMV, FLV, WebM, H.264, H.265 (HEVC), VP9. Support for MKV containers and newer codecs like H.265 and VP9 is crucial for playing a wide range of video content.
Furthermore, F Player should include:
* **Codec Support:** Leveraging both hardware and software codecs to ensure optimal playback performance for all supported formats.
* **Automatic Codec Updates:** Regularly updating codecs to maintain compatibility with the latest media formats.
* **Error Handling:** Providing informative error messages when encountering unsupported formats or codec issues.
**Customization: Tailoring the Experience**
The ability to customize the playback experience is a key differentiator for third-party media players. F Player should offer a range of customization options, allowing users to fine-tune the app to their preferences. These could include:
* **Equalizer:** A customizable equalizer allows users to adjust the frequency response of audio playback to suit their listening preferences. F Player should offer a range of preset equalizer settings (e.g., rock, jazz, classical) as well as the ability to create and save custom equalizer profiles.
* **Video Playback Settings:** Customizable video playback settings, such as brightness, contrast, saturation, and hue, allow users to optimize the viewing experience.
* **Subtitle Support:** Support for external subtitle files (e.g., SRT, ASS, SSA) is crucial for watching foreign films or videos with dialogue that is difficult to understand. F Player should allow users to load subtitle files, customize their appearance (e.g., font, size, color), and adjust their synchronization with the video.
* **Audio Boost and Normalization:** Audio boost can amplify the volume of quiet audio tracks, while audio normalization can even out the volume levels across different tracks.
* **Gesture Customization:** Allowing users to customize the functionality of gesture controls provides a more personalized and efficient interaction.
* **Sleep Timer:** A sleep timer allows users to automatically stop playback after a specified period of time, which is particularly useful for listening to music or podcasts before bed.
**Advantages Over Native iOS Media Players**
While the native iOS media players are functional and well-integrated into the ecosystem, F Player can offer several advantages:
* **Wider Format Compatibility:** Native players often lack support for certain formats like MKV, FLAC, and some codecs.
* **Enhanced Customization:** Native players typically offer limited customization options.
* **Advanced Features:** Features like playback speed control, A-B repeat, and more granular equalizer settings are often missing in native players.
* **Library Management:** F Player can provide more robust library management features, particularly for users with large media collections.
* **Cross-Platform Support:** While F Player is envisioned as an iOS app, many similar apps offer versions for other platforms (Android, macOS, Windows), allowing users to seamlessly sync their media libraries across devices.
**Potential Challenges and Considerations**
Developing a successful media player app for iOS presents several challenges:
* **Resource Constraints:** iOS devices have limited processing power and battery life. F Player needs to be optimized for performance to minimize battery drain and prevent overheating.
* **Memory Management:** Efficient memory management is crucial to prevent crashes and ensure smooth playback, especially with large media files.
* **iOS Updates:** Apple regularly releases iOS updates that can introduce changes that affect the functionality of third-party apps. F Player needs to be regularly updated to maintain compatibility with the latest iOS versions.
* **DRM and Copyright:** Handling DRM-protected content requires careful consideration to avoid copyright infringement.
* **App Store Approval:** Apple has strict guidelines for app store approval. F Player needs to adhere to these guidelines to be approved and remain available in the App Store.
**Conclusion**
F Player, as a hypothetical iOS media player, represents the desire for a more feature-rich, customizable, and versatile media playback experience on Apple devices. By offering broader format compatibility, enhanced customization options, and advanced features, F Player can cater to the needs of users who seek more control over their audio and video consumption. While challenges exist in developing and maintaining such an application, the potential benefits for users seeking a superior media playback experience are significant. The success of F Player, or any similar app, hinges on a combination of robust functionality, intuitive design, and a commitment to ongoing development and support. In a market saturated with streaming services, there's still a significant demand for offline playback and personalized media management, making a well-executed media player a valuable addition to the iOS app ecosystem.